Transaction 84a4083079433720829e43e8b03c51f58d37f0f63ba031623bf7b18e05b36831

3 Input
2 Outputs
  • 84a4083079433720829e43e8b03c51f58d37f0f63ba031623bf7b18e05b36831:0
  • value  7460848
    address  bc1qleyxwpx7qexjvjdjc8fcvm36gmvhnrvygfsslz
  • 84a4083079433720829e43e8b03c51f58d37f0f63ba031623bf7b18e05b36831:1
  • value  5158225
    address  1adbuP4Q7ttpyesyzCZ3Z8dLeMSZp2GbT